The East Fork Chattooga River (sometimes East Prong Chattooga River) runs in from Jackson County, North Carolina and then Oconee County, South Carolina, and is 7.4 miles (11.9 km) long. The West Fork Chattooga River (variant name Gumekoloke Creek) runs in from Rabun County, Georgia, and is also a variant name for that county's Holcombe Creek, one of its own tributaries. Since May 10 1974, the Chattooga River has been protected along a 15,432-acre corridor as a national Wild and Scenic River. The entire West Fork, plus 1 mile upstream along Overflow Creek, is included within the boundaries of the Chattooga National Wild and Scenic River. The GPS coordinates for this Stream are 34.9167572 (latitude), -83.1695976 (longitude) and the approximate elevation is 1,575 feet (480 meters) above sea level.
